DEV Community

Cover image for User Experience (UX) vs User Interface (UI)
Abiodun Owadoye
Abiodun Owadoye

Posted on • Edited on

User Experience (UX) vs User Interface (UI)

Understanding UX and UI

UX (User Experience) and UI (User Interface) and are two important aspects of creating a successful product. They both play a crucial role in the design and development process, and are closely related, but have distinct differences.

UI, or User Interface, refers to the visual and interactive elements of a product, such as a layout, buttons, and overall look and feel of the product. It is all about making the product easy to use, visually appealing, and accessible to the user. UI designers focus on creating a user-friendly interface that is easy to navigate, and that guides the user through the product.

UX, or User Experience, on the other hand, is the overall experience a user has when interacting with a product. It is all about understanding the user's needs, wants, and pain points and creating a product that addresses them. UX designers focus on creating a product that is intuitive, user-centered, and that provides a seamless experience to the user.

Both UI and UX are crucial in creating a successful product. Without a good UI, the product may be difficult to use and understand, and without a good UX, the product may not meet the user's needs or provide a positive experience. A good UI should make the product easy to use and understand, while a good UX should make the product meet the user's needs and provide a positive experience.

When designing and developing a product, it is important to consider both UI and UX. The UI should be visually appealing and easy to use, and the UX should be user-centered and provide a seamless experience. By considering both UI and UX, a product can be designed and developed that is both user-friendly and meets the user's needs.

Understanding UI

Understanding UI, or User Interface, is essential for creating a successful product. UI is the visual and interactive elements of a product, such as a layout, buttons, and overall look and feel of the product. It is all about making the product easy to use, visually appealing, and accessible to the user. UI designers focus on creating a user-friendly interface that is easy to navigate, and that guides the user through the product.

There are several elements of UI that are important to consider when designing a product. These include layout, colors, typography, and images.

  • Layout refers to the arrangement of elements on a page: It is important to consider the placement of elements, such as buttons and text, to create a visually appealing and easy-to-use interface.

  • Colors play an important role in creating a visually appealing UI. The use of color can create a sense of hierarchy, direct the user's attention, and evoke certain emotions.

  • Typography is also an important element of UI. The use of different font styles and sizes can create a hierarchy and make the text more readable.

  • Images are also a key element of UI. They can be used to create visual interest and add context to the product.

A good UI should be visually appealing, easy to use, and accessible to the user. It should also provide a seamless experience that guides the user through the product. A good UI can affect user engagement and conversion rates by providing a positive experience that keeps users on the product and encourages them to take the desired action. A poorly designed UI can have the opposite effect and discourage users from using the product or taking the desired action.

Understanding UX

Understanding UX, or User Experience, is essential for creating a successful product. UX is the overall experience a user has when interacting with a product. It is all about understanding the user's needs, wants, and pain points, and creating a product that addresses them. UX designers focus on creating a product that is intuitive, user-centered, and that provides a seamless experience to the user.

There are several elements of UX that are important to consider when designing a product. These include usability, accessibility, desirability, and value.

  • Usability refers to how easy the product is to use and understand. It is important to consider the user's level of expertise and create a product that is easy to use and understand, even for those with little experience.

  • Accessibility refers to how easy the product is to use for people with disabilities. It is important to consider accessibility when designing a product, to ensure that everyone can use it.

  • Desirability refers to how much the user wants to use the product. It is important to consider the user's needs and wants when designing a product and creating something that the user will want to use.

  • Value refers to how much the user gets out of the product. It is important to create a product that provides value to the user, by addressing their needs and providing a positive experience.

A good UX should be user-centered and provide a seamless experience. It should also be intuitive and easy to use. A good UX can affect user satisfaction and loyalty by providing a positive experience that keeps users engaged and coming back. A poorly designed UX can have the opposite effect and discourage users from using the product or returning.

Differences between UI and UX

When it comes to designing a product, it is important to understand the differences between UI and UX. Both UI and UX play important roles in creating a successful product, but they focus on different aspects of the design process.

UI, or User Interface, focuses on the visual design and aesthetics of a product. It is all about creating a visually appealing and easy-to-use interface that guides the user through the product. UI designers focus on elements such as layout, colors, typography, and images, and how they can be used to create a visually appealing and user-friendly interface.

UX, or User Experience, on the other hand, focuses on the overall user experience. It is all about understanding the user's needs, wants, and pain points, and creating a product that addresses them. UX designers focus on creating a product that is intuitive, user-centered, and that provides a seamless experience to the user. They consider usability, accessibility, desirability, and value when designing a product.

Importance of UI and UX in web and mobile development

UI and UX design play a critical role in web and mobile development. They are essential for creating a successful product that provides a positive user experience. In today's digital age, the majority of people access the internet and use mobile apps on a daily basis. Therefore, it's essential for websites and mobile apps to have a user-centered design that provides a seamless and enjoyable experience for the user.

Principles of UI and Ux design

The principles of UI and UX design are applied in web and mobile development through a variety of methods such as user research, wireframing, prototyping, and testing. User research is conducted to understand user needs, wants, and pain points, and to create a product that addresses them. Wireframing and prototyping are used to create a visual representation of the product and test its usability. Testing is done to ensure that the product is user-friendly and meets the user's needs.

There are many popular websites and apps that have implemented UI and UX design principles to create a positive user experience. For example, the website of Amazon has a clean and simple layout, with easy navigation, making it easy for users to find what they're looking for. The mobile app of Uber has a user-friendly interface that allows users to quickly and easily request a ride.

Another example is the website of Airbnb, which has a visually appealing and user-friendly layout, making it easy for users to find and book a place to stay. The mobile app of Instagram has a simple and intuitive design that makes it easy for users to share and view photos and videos. These are just a few examples of how UI and UX design principles are applied in web and mobile development to create a positive user experience.

The process of UI and UX design

The process of UI and UX design is a multi-faceted and iterative process that involves several stages. The process starts with research and analysis, followed by design and prototyping, and finally, user testing and iteration.

The first stage of the process is research and analysis. This is where the designer conducts user research to understand the user's needs, wants, and pain points. The designer may use various research methods such as surveys, interviews, and user testing to gather data. This data is then analyzed to identify patterns and insights that will inform the design process.

The next stage is design and prototyping. This is where the designer uses the insights gained from the research and analysis stage to create a visual representation of the product. The designer may use wireframes and mockups to create a low-fidelity prototype of the product. This prototype is then refined and polished to create a high-fidelity prototype that closely represents the final product.

The final stage of the process is user testing and iteration. This is where the prototype is tested with real users to gather feedback on its usability, accessibility, and desirability. The designer then uses this feedback to make improvements and refinements to the product. This process is repeated until the product meets the user's needs and provides a positive user experience.

Conclusion

In conclusion, UI and UX play crucial roles in creating successful products. UI, or user interface, focuses on the visual design and aesthetics of a product, while UX, or user experience, focuses on the overall user experience. Both UI and UX are essential in creating products that are not only visually appealing but also easy to use and understand.

It's important to note that while UI and UX may seem like separate entities, they are closely intertwined and both are necessary for creating a successful product. A well-designed UI can improve user engagement and conversion rates, while a well-designed UX can increase user satisfaction and loyalty.

In web and mobile development, UI and UX design principles are applied to create products that are visually pleasing, easy to use, and accessible to all users. The process of UI and UX design involves several stages, including research and analysis, design and prototyping, and user testing and iteration. This process helps ensure that the product meets the user's needs and provides a positive user experience.

Top comments (2)

Collapse
 
mimisan profile image
Tech reven

Thank you for this, I really needed it

Collapse
 
abitech profile image
Abiodun Owadoye

You are welcome. Am glad it helped